Silymarin: A Natural Ally for Liver Health and Detoxification

Herb Silymarin for Natural Liver Health

The liver is a vital organ that plays a crucial role in detoxifying the body, aiding digestion, and regulating metabolism. Given its importance, maintaining liver health is essential for overall well-being. One natural remedy that has gained attention for its liver-protective properties is silymarin, an active compound found in milk thistle. This article delves into the benefits of silymarin for liver health, supported by scientific research and clinical studies.

Understanding Silymarin and Its Origins

Silymarin is a flavonoid complex extracted from the seeds of the milk thistle plant (Silybum marianum), which has been used for over 2000 years as a herbal remedy for various ailments, particularly liver problems. The complex is composed of several isomers, with silybin being the most active and abundant.

The Science Behind Silymarin’s Liver-Protective Effects

Research has shown that silymarin exerts a hepatoprotective effect through various mechanisms:

  • Antioxidant Activity: Silymarin neutralizes free radicals and increases the levels of glutathione, a powerful antioxidant in the liver.
  • Anti-inflammatory Properties: It reduces inflammation by inhibiting the release of pro-inflammatory substances.
  • Regeneration of Liver Cells: Silymarin promotes the growth of new liver cells by stimulating protein synthesis.
  • Stabilization of Cell Membranes: It prevents toxins from entering liver cells by stabilizing cell membranes.

These actions make silymarin a promising natural treatment for liver diseases such as cirrhosis, jaundice, hepatitis, and liver damage caused by toxins.

Clinical Evidence Supporting Silymarin’s Efficacy

Several clinical studies have investigated the therapeutic benefits of silymarin for liver health:

  • A study published in the World Journal of Hepatology found that silymarin significantly improved liver function in patients with alcoholic liver disease.
  • Research in the Journal of Hepatology demonstrated that silymarin could be beneficial for patients with non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D), reducing liver enzyme levels and improving insulin resistance.
  • A meta-analysis in the European Journal of Gastroenterology & Hepatology concluded that silymarin has a positive effect on liver-related mortality for patients with cirrhosis.

These studies provide a strong foundation for the use of silymarin as a supplement for liver health.

Precautions and Potential Side Effects

While silymarin is generally considered safe, it can interact with certain medications and may not be suitable for everyone. Possible side effects include gastrointestinal upset, allergic reactions, and, in rare cases, liver damage when taken in excessive amounts. Always seek medical advice before taking silymarin, especially if you have a pre-existing medical condition or are pregnant or breastfeeding.
